Practice problems

# Question
1 How many milliliters of water should be added to 60 ml of a 48 % (w/v) solution to prepare 21 % w/v solution?
2 If 205 ml of a 45 % v/v solution is diluted to 2000 ml , what is the percent strength of the diluted solution?
3 If 365 ml of a 1 : 90 (w/v) solution is diluted to 1000 ml, what is the ratio strength of the new solution?
4 If 40 ml of a 2.00 % nasal spray was diluted with 4 ml of normal saline solution, what would be the final drug concentration?
5 How many milliliters of a 7 % elixir can be prepared from 85 ml of a 83 % elixir?
6 If a cough syrup contains 7 mg of a drug in each teaspoonful, how many mg of drug needs to be added to a 60 ml container of the syrup to make the concentration 4 mg/ml?
7 What is the percentage strength (v/v) of an alcohol mixture that has a mix of 400 ml of 40 % alcohol, 125 ml of 50 % alcohol, and 240 ml of 15 % alcohol?
8 A pharmacist combines 6 pints of a 5 % w/v povidone-iodine solution with 7 quarts of 10 % w/v povidone-iodine solution. What is the strength of the resulting solution?
9

How many milliliters of 6 % and a 11 % solution do you need to prepare 2 gallon of 8 % solution?

10

What proportion of 25 % zinc oxide and 35 % zinc oxide do you need to make 30 % zinc oxide?

11

How many grams of 3 % hydrocortisone cream be mixed with 640 g of 0.5 % hydrocortisone cream to make a 2.00 % hydrocortisone cream?

12

How many milliliters of water should be added to 1.25 L of 1: 600 w/v solution to make a 1: 6500 w/v solution?

13

How many grams of a 4.00 % w/w benzocaine ointment can be prepared by diluting 1 lb of a 20 % w/w benzocaine ointment with white petrolatum?

14

How many milliliters of a 13 % w/v stock solution benzalkonium chloride should be used in preparing the following prescription?

Benzalkonium chloride solution 410 ml
Make a solution such that
10 ml diluted to 1 L equals a 1: 5500 w/v solution
Sig : 10 ml diluted to a liter for external use

15

How many milliliters of 85 % (w/w) lactic acid with a specific gravity of 1.21 be used to prepare 320 ml of 62 % (w/v) lactic acid solution?

16

What is the specific gravity of a mixture containing 700 ml of water, 1250 ml of glycerin having a specific gravity of 1.25, and 1300 ml of alcohol having a specific gravity of 0.81?

17

How many milliliters of a syrup having a specific gravity of 1.49 should be mixed with 3500 mL of a syrup having a specific gravity of 1.25 to obtain a product having a specific gravity of 1.47?
